style: 简化log模块代码

This commit is contained in:
Mmx233
2022-03-02 22:58:21 +08:00
parent 525c063cf0
commit fc94672038

View File

@@ -47,7 +47,8 @@ func (c *loG) WriteLog(name string, a ...interface{}) {
} }
} }
func (c *loG) print(fatal bool, a ...interface{}) { func (c *loG) print(name string, fatal bool, a ...interface{}) {
a = append([]interface{}{"[" + name + "] "}, a...)
if c.DebugMode && c.WriteFile { if c.DebugMode && c.WriteFile {
c.WriteLog("Login-"+c.timeStamp+".log", a...) c.WriteLog("Login-"+c.timeStamp+".log", a...)
} }
@@ -66,18 +67,18 @@ func (c *loG) print(fatal bool, a ...interface{}) {
func (c *loG) Debug(a ...interface{}) { func (c *loG) Debug(a ...interface{}) {
if c.DebugMode { if c.DebugMode {
c.print(false, append([]interface{}{"[DEBUG] "}, a...)...) c.print("DEBUG", false, a...)
} }
} }
func (c *loG) Info(a ...interface{}) { func (c *loG) Info(a ...interface{}) {
c.print(false, append([]interface{}{"[INFO] "}, a...)...) c.print("INFO", false, a...)
} }
func (c *loG) Warn(a ...interface{}) { func (c *loG) Warn(a ...interface{}) {
c.print(false, append([]interface{}{"[WARN] "}, a...)...) c.print("WARN", false, a...)
} }
func (c *loG) Fatal(a ...interface{}) { func (c *loG) Fatal(a ...interface{}) {
c.print(true, append([]interface{}{"[FATAL] "}, a...)...) c.print("FATAL", true, a...)
} }